razvanteslaru
Thanks, all! :) Jeanette, if you mean that Knewton's tests are harder than what you can expect on the actual test then yes, you're right. They're harder, but I think they're meant that way.

Well that's only kind of what I mean. I mean I think the score, especially on the diagnostic, may be made to be lower than it should be so that people score very lowly on it. Remember that knewton has a moneyback guarantee if you don't improve by at least 50 points, so they have a reason to want to have you score lower on your diagnostic.
